What Nova Luxe Handles
Design, engineering, and permitting under one team.
You don't need to manage the seams between architect, structural engineer, MEP designer, civil engineer, and city permitting.
- 01Architectural coordination
We work alongside your architect from concept through construction documents, or introduce architects whose style and discipline fit your project.
- 02Structural engineering
Coordination with the engineer of record on foundation, framing, and load-path decisions — informed by the fact that we self-perform structure.
- 03MEP coordination
Mechanical, electrical, and plumbing designers pulled into design conversations before rough-ins are drawn.
- 04Civil & site engineering
Drainage, grading, and site work planned before foundations, not after.
- 05Permitting management
Nova Luxe pulls the permit under our GC license and manages the reviewer relationship through approval.
- 06Value engineering
Constructability review to align design intent with buildable reality — protecting the design, not undercutting it.
- 07Constructability review
The drawing set audited against real construction sequencing before scope is committed.

Why Nova Luxe
The builder in the design conversation from day one.
The reason so many custom homes drift off-budget or off-schedule is that the builder joins the conversation after the drawings are done. Nova Luxe joins earlier.
Constructability, structural coordination, and scheduling brought into design before it's locked.
Because we self-perform framing and concrete, we can inform structural decisions rather than react to them.
Nova Luxe pulls the permit and manages the reviewer relationship — not the owner, not the architect.
Rough-in reality reviewed against finish design before drywall closes options.
